The last of my tasting notes from our Willamette Valley winery tour in May.

Stone Wolf winery

Muller Thurgau 2009
Very pale straw. Funky-earthy nose. Midpalate is citrusy with fresh acidity. Medium finish.

Chardonnay 2009 12.55 abv

Pale yellow Light pear nose with some spiciness. Green apple fruit and good acidity on the midpalate with nice medium finish.

Penner-Ash winery

Vigonier 2010 13.5% abv $30 bottle

Pale yellow. Expressive nose of ripe pineapple and mango. Sharp acidity with juicy tropical fruit on the midpalate. Medium acidic fruit finish. Nice wine.

Argyle winery

Brut 2007 12.55 abv $27
Nice straw color. Yeasty lemon nose. Medium mousse. Midpalate has slightly sweet homemade lemonade notes and smooth but detectable tannins. Medium finish. 63% chard, 37% pinot noir

Blanc de blancs 2006 100% chard, Dijon clone
Light yellow. Rich lemon custard nose with some oak. Medium fine mousse. Midpalate has rich caramel taste with some residual sweetness. Medium to long finish of acidic fruit and some tannic twang. Nice balance.

Winderlea winery

Chardonnay 2008 13.5% abv (blend from different vineyards)
Pale lemon yellow. Light oak and lemony nose. Light fruit and good acidity on the midpalate with smooth tannins. Light to medium bodied with a medium finish.
